Why Choosing the Right PEX Size Matters for Your Plumbing System
Selecting the correct PEX size is more than just a technical detail—it’s a decision that directly impacts the efficiency, performance, and longevity of your home’s plumbing system. Using the wrong size can lead to a host of problems that disrupt daily life and result in costly repairs.
Key Reasons Why PEX Size Matters:
- Optimal Water Flow: Undersized pipes restrict water flow, leading to low pressure at faucets, showers, and appliances. This can be frustrating and inconvenient, especially in homes with multiple fixtures in use simultaneously.
- Energy Efficiency: Properly sized PEX pipes reduce the strain on water heaters and pumps, confirming energy is used efficiently. Oversized pipes, on the other hand, may require more water to fill, increasing energy consumption.
- Preventing Damage: Incorrect sizing can cause issues like water hammer (loud banging noises in pipes) or uneven heating in radiant floor systems. Over time, these problems can damage pipes and fixtures, leading to leaks or costly replacements.
For homeowners, investing time in selecting the right PEX size confirms smooth, reliable plumbing performance while avoiding unnecessary expenses down the line.
Factors to Consider When Choosing PEX Sizes
Choosing the right PEX size involves evaluating several key factors that influence your plumbing system’s performance. Below, we break down the most important considerations to help you make an informed decision.
Household Water Demand
The number of bathrooms, fixtures, and appliances in your home directly impacts water demand. Larger homes with multiple bathrooms or high-flow fixtures may require larger PEX sizes to confirm adequate water pressure and flow. For example, ½-inch PEX is typically sufficient for smaller homes, while ¾-inch PEX may be needed for larger households or homes with high water usage.
Fixture Requirements
Different fixtures have varying flow rate requirements. Showers, dishwashers, and washing machines often need higher flow rates compared to sinks or toilets. Make sure the PEX size can accommodate the demands of all connected fixtures without compromising performance.
Local Building Codes
Building codes in your area may specify minimum PEX sizes for residential plumbing. These regulations are designed to confirm safety, efficiency, and compliance with industry standards. Always check local guidelines or consult a professional to avoid violations.
Layout and Distance
The distance between the water source and fixtures affects pipe sizing. Longer runs may require larger PEX sizes to compensate for pressure loss over distance. Similarly, complex layouts with multiple branches may need careful planning to maintain consistent water flow.
Future-Proofing Your System
Consider potential changes to your home, such as adding bathrooms or upgrading appliances. Choosing slightly larger PEX sizes now can accommodate future needs and prevent costly upgrades later.
Common Mistakes to Avoid When Selecting PEX Sizes
Choosing the wrong PEX size can lead to inefficiencies, increased costs, and plumbing headaches down the line. To make sure your system performs optimally, it’s important to avoid these common mistakes:
Underestimating Water Demand
One frequent error is underestimating your household’s water needs. For example:
- Installing ½-inch PEX in a large home with multiple bathrooms or high-flow fixtures can result in frustratingly low water pressure when several appliances or faucets are in use.
- Always consider peak demand to secure consistent performance across all fixtures.
Ignoring Local Building Codes
Another pitfall is failing to adhere to local building codes. Some regions have specific requirements for PEX sizes to confirm safety and efficiency.
- Why it matters: Non-compliance can lead to fines or forced rework, adding unnecessary costs and delays.
- Always verify local guidelines or consult a professional before proceeding.
Overlooking Future Needs
Many homeowners focus solely on their current plumbing setup without considering future expansions or upgrades.
- For instance, if you plan to add a bathroom or install a high-flow appliance, undersized pipes may not meet the increased demand.
- Choosing slightly larger PEX sizes now can save you from costly upgrades later.
